“…In addition, probiotics can be added to a biofloc system in shrimp culture to potentially improve shrimp production, although the selection probiotics is crucial. The addition of commercial probiotics did not improve the growth, survival and feed conversion rate of whiteleg shrimp during the nursery phase ( Arias-Moscoso et al, 2018 ) whereas Amjad et al (2022) reported that the probiotics-added biofloc systems improved water quality and growth of P. vannamei juvveniles.…”

“…Alkalinity is considered an important water parameter to maintain a steady pH level in the culture unit. Several other studies documented the reduction in alkalinity levels in the BFT systems [6,9,35,36]. Different chemicals such as NaHCO 3 and CaCO 3 are commonly used to maintain alkalinity levels in BFT systems [27].…”

“…The addition of probiotics in vannamei shrimp aquaculture can affect water quality. Table-3 shows the role that probiotics play in maintaining good water quality [12,[82][83][84][85][86][87][88][89][90]. The addition of probiotics or external bacteria, such as nitrifying bacteria or Lactobacillus and Bacillus spp., have been shown to affect dissolved oxygen, pH, ammonia, and alkalinity concentrations in water [12,82,83], since these bacteria oxidize ammonia to nitrite and convert nitrite to nitrate [91].…”

“…Surprisingly, the use of probiotics in water reduces the dissolved oxygen content in the water, even though it is still within the safe limits for the needs of vannamei shrimp (>5 mg/L) [ 84 , 95 ]. This could be a consequence of the greater abundance of bacteria in the water when probiotics are administered to it.…”
